Factors Affecting Cannabinoid Stability

Several factors can affect the cannabinoid stability over time. One key factor is temperature. High temperatures can accelerate the degradation of cannabinoids. This means storing your cannabis in a cool, dark place helps maintain its quality. For instance, keeping your cannabis in a basement or a dedicated storage container can be beneficial.

Another major factor is humidity. Too much moisture can lead to mold. On the flip side, too little can dry out your cannabis, affecting its potency. Striking the right balance is crucial. Using humidity packs can help maintain the ideal conditions for strains like GG4 x Z OG from Blimburn Seeds.

Knowing the cannabinoids vs time: stability curve requires careful attention to the storage environment. The interplay of temperature and humidity can greatly influence the degradation rate of cannabinoids over time. By optimizing these conditions, you can enhance the longevity and effectiveness of your cannabis products.

Light exposure is another critical factor that can impact cannabinoid stability. Ultraviolet light can break down cannabinoids, reducing their potency. Investing in UV-blocking containers or storage solutions can help protect your cannabis from these harmful rays, ensuring that the cannabinoids remain intact and effective over time.

Storage Techniques for Long-term Cannabinoid Stability

Proper storage techniques are essential for ensuring long-term cannabinoid stability. Using airtight containers is a simple yet effective method. These containers prevent air from getting in, thus reducing the degradation rate of cannabinoids over time. Mason jars, for example, are a popular choice among growers.

Refrigeration is another technique. It slows down the degradation process. However, be cautious with freezer storage. While it can be effective, frequent thawing and refreezing can harm the cannabinoids. Keeping a strain like Sour Diesel from Blimburn Seeds in the fridge can help maintain its potency over time.

Besides to these methods, desiccants can be useful in maintaining the right moisture levels within storage containers. These substances absorb excess moisture, preventing mold and preserving the cannabinoid stability over time. For those storing large quantities, investing in a dedicated cannabis humidor can further ensure optimal conditions.

Regular monitoring of storage conditions is vital for long-term cannabinoid stability analysis. Using hygrometers and thermometers can help keep track of humidity and temperature levels, allowing for timely adjustments. This proactive approach ensures that your cannabis remains potent and effective, preserving its cannabinoid profile.

Identifying Signs of Cannabinoid Degradation

Over time, you might notice changes in your cannabis. These changes are often signs of cannabinoid degradation. One of the most common indicators is a change in color. If your cannabis looks browner than usual, it might be past its prime. This is a clear sign that the cannabinoids have started to break down.

A change in aroma can also indicate degradation. Fresh cannabis has a distinct smell. If it starts to smell musty or less potent, it may have lost some of its cannabinoid content. The effects of time on cannabinoid degradation can also be felt in the flavor. If your cannabis tastes flat, it might be time to get a new batch.

Texture changes can also be a telltale sign of degradation. Cannabis that feels excessively dry or brittle may have lost its moisture content, impacting its overall quality and cannabinoid stability over time. Conversely, overly moist cannabis may indicate improper storage conditions leading to degradation.

Knowing these signs is crucial as part of a comprehensive cannabinoids time-dependent stability study. By recognizing these indicators early, you can take corrective actions to prevent further degradation, ensuring that you get the most out of your cannabis products.

Degradation Rate of Cannabinoids Over Time

The degradation rate of cannabinoids over time can vary. Factors like strain type, storage conditions, and initial quality all play a part. Typically, cannabinoids like THC and CBD degrade at different rates. THC can convert into CBN, a compound with different effects, while CBD remains relatively stable over time.

Research into cannabinoids time-dependent stability study shows that, on average, cannabis can lose up to 17% of its THC content after a year if not stored properly. This highlights the importance of maintaining optimal storage conditions to preserve the cannabinoid profile of your cannabis.

Long-term cannabinoid stability analysis is essential for both consumers and cultivators. By knowing how different cannabinoids degrade over time, you can make informed decisions about storage and consumption. This knowledge also aids in selecting strains that meet specific stability needs.

It’s important to note that the degradation rate of cannabinoids over time is not uniform across all strains. Some strains may be more resilient due to their unique cannabinoid profiles and terpene content. By studying these variables, you can optimize your storage practices and enhance the longevity of your cannabis.
